Frequently
Asked Questions
- How long should I plan to spend during a visit to The Heritage
Society?
Plan to stay for about two hours if you tour the historic houses. Guided
tours last about an hour and 15 minutes.
Can I purchase tickets in advance?
Group tours require a $20.00 deposit to hold the tour date. Advance
tickets are not available for other tours.
Can I tour the historic structures on my own?
No. The only way to see the inside of the historic houses is on a guided
tour.
Can I tour the park and gardens only?
Yes. Sam Houston Park is a public park and you may walk around the
grounds at your leisure.
What can my children do at The Heritage Society?
The Heritage Society offers a variety of family activities
throughout the year. Please check our Calendar of Events for upcoming
programs. On a tour, children may visit Heritage Society museum gallery and can tour the Duncan Store, a hands-on
exhibit where children can play with
toys popular in the nineteenth-century or try their hand at churning
butter.
Where do I park and how much does it cost?
Visitors enjoy free parking in the lot located behind the white
brick Kellum-Noble House. The parking lot is located just off Allen
Parkway inbound.
Where can I eat?
There are no restaurant facilities available onsite at this time.
However, there are a number of restaurants and cafeterias in the
vicinity.
Is there a gift shop?
The Heritage Society has a small gift shop located in the museum.
How can I access your library and archives?
The library and archives are available by appointment only. Please
call 713.683.0188 for more information.
